- The primary responsibility will be the strategic execution and management of a comprehensive annual giving program, including the coordination and oversight of supporting initiatives in the areas of development services and donor relations.
- This position will develop a coordinated matrix of communication and solicitation strategies involving email, direct mail, phone/mail, personal visitation, and volunteer engagement, all focused on shaping a sustainable tradition of annual support.
- In addition, the officer will foster the growth of best practices in the supporting areas of gift processing, data management and donor relations as related to annual giving and the University as a whole and augment the foundation of annual giving as the enabling component of successful major and gift planning programs.
- The officer will provide strategic direction and long-range/short-range planning for all these areas in the context of growing the annual giving program while supporting the greater development goals of the University.
- The officer is responsible for ensuring that the University is a leader among peers as measured externally in terms of total dollars, percentage participation, consistency of giving and average gift size and internally in terms of clean data, ease of access to data and timely donor stewardship.
- The officer will support design and implementation of comprehensive fundraising plans to achieve fiscal objectives. These plans include identifying, cultivating, and soliciting support from the University's key constituencies alumni, trustees, friends, corporations, foundations, organizations and associations. Key programs include, but are not limited to major giving, corporate and foundation relations, alumni relations and the General Alumni Association, and annual and community giving.
- Provide strategic leadership for the continued advancement of Fisk's ongoing relationship with its external constituencies and specifically the Nashville community.
- Manage, motivate, and carefully coordinate staff and volunteers to establish and achieve short-term and long-range goals in institutional advancement. Such goals range from increases in the quality and quantity of information collected and maintained, to numbers of alumni actively engaged, and numbers of donors and dollars raised.
- Work closely with the Executive Vice President in articulating and promoting priorities, the image, mission, and integrity of Fisk University and soliciting support from key constituencies, particularly major gift donors and prospects of all types, as well as the alumni body in general.
- Assure continuous improvement in the overall advancement programs and infrastructure - including information management (prospect identification and tracking system; gift and biographical records; personal gift solicitation (major, special, and annual) from all types of constituents; proposal development; "direct response" (through mail, e-mail, telemarketing); cultivation and engagement programs.

The Annual and Planned Giving Officer works collaboratively with diverse individuals and groups, both within and outside the University, to advance Fisk's mission, vision, and strategic priorities.
The Annual and Planned Giving Officer is tasked with initiating and building relationships with local/national businesses, community organizations, alumni (including Fisk Alumni Association members and Clubs), as well as high net worth individuals.
The Annual and Planned Giving Officer supports the University's Division of Institutional Advancement and provides leadership in planning and implementing strategies to maximize voluntary support from all its constituencies, especially its approximately 7,300 alumni.
Voluntary support is meant primarily to be financial gifts and grants; it also means volunteer assistance on the part of alumni, students, faculty, and other key constituencies.
Beyond an intentional focus on increased annual giving, this role also demands broadening the base of planned givers with a focus on wills, trusts and estate planning.
